Rosella Amsden Jarvis passed away on December 31, 2017 at her home in Lake Placid, FL after a long illness.
Rosella is survived by her sister Annette Amsden Tabor and husband Clark Tabor, her children: Roxanna Loveday, Peter Jarvis and his wife Elizabeth, Vicki DuBois, Sherri Thompson and her husband Fred, Tami Hoag and Yvonne Jarvis plus grandchildren and great grandchildren.
She was born in Brookfield, VT, attended high school in Randolph, VT. She married Howard H. Jarvis on February 27, 1954. They had 7 children.
Known as Rose to all her friends, she enjoyed spending time with family and friends, camping, playing cards, doing crossword puzzles and baking.
She and Howard moved to Florida from Massachusetts in 2001, lived for a short time in Sebring before finding their home in Lakeside Mobile Home Park in Lake Placid.
She was an active member of the VFW Auxiliary Post 3880 Lake Placid where she served as Treasurer for several years.
